The Bravos head inside, but they are being watched

The Bravos made their way through the grand courtyard that marked the entryway to the Manor, their eyes focused straight ahead, largely ignoring the impressive assortment of carefully manicured topiaries and exotic plants from across the world. Well, Becky might've strayed a bit from the group, when a particularly rare and useful plant happened to catch her eye, but they still stuck together until reaching the wide open doors that lead into a grand receiving chamber, filled with guests quietly chatting among themselves, wine glasses in hand.

Nearly everyone in the place was dressed to the nines, vividly colored clothes, often with gemstones set into the very fabric. Luckily, with their well done up gowns, the Bravos fit right in.

As they moved about, the Bravos were entirely unaware of sets of eyes, watching them from behind masks and out of shadowy corners of the room. Someone here was already away of their goal, and he was ready to put a stop to it.

Their mysterious voyeur knew that taking them down in the open, in the middle of the party would not only be incredibly hard, but would sow unnecessary chaos among the party guests. Of course, Lady Dieudonne would be furious as well if he commanded a full on **** in the middle of her party, and he was ever at the whim of his mistress's commands.

He would try to separate them, to get the Bravos each alone without arousing suspicion from them. He was also aware of a slightly smaller troublemaker who would be arriving at the party shortly, but he doubted he would have much trouble dealing with her alone.

The spymaster proceeded toward Lady Dieudonne's chambers-- they Lady should be quite pleased indeed to hear the news that the Bravos had arrived under his ever watchful eyes. It was moreso a courtesy visit than anything else-- he had already received full clearance to do anything necessary to keep the Diadem safe, alongside clear instructions taht the Bravos were to be captured, not killed, and suffering as little harm as possible. The restrictions were perhaps a bit silly, but the challenge was part of what made this so much fun.
